Objective: Intravenous catheters are usually inserted with the bevel facing up. Bevel down may be superior in small and/or dehydrated children.Where should bevel be facing?
Orient the bevel parallel to the longitudinal dural fibers to increase the chances that the needle will separate the fibers rather than cut them; in the lateral recumbent position, the bevel should face up, and in the sitting position, it should face to one side or the other. How do you use a bevel needle?
Prevention
- Place tourniquet approximately 5 inches above proposed entry site.
- Identify vein and alcohol antiseptic swab.
- Skin pulled in opposite direction of needle.
- With bevel up, enter at a 30-degree angle.
- Perforate vein and decrease angle with slight advancement.
- Remove tourniquet.

If the bevel of the needle is resting against the lower or upper wall of the vein, blood flow can be affected – this problem can easily be fixed by changing the needle angle.Which of the following is the proper orientation of the bevel when inserting a needle for venipuncture?
Application of traction. Inform the patient that you are about to introduce the needle, then insert the needle, with the bevel facing up (see the image below), at an angle of 15-30°.What angle should the needle be when drawing blood?
The needle should form a 15 to 30 degree angle with the surface of the arm. Swiftly insert the needle through the skin and into the lumen of the vein. Avoid trauma and excessive probing. When the last tube to be drawn is filling, remove the tourniquet.How far do you insert needle for intramuscular injection?
